“War and Nature: Memorial Water Vines”

Artist: Scottie Kersta-Wilson
Title: War and Nature: Memorial Water Vine
Size: 80” x 20”
Medium: Silk chiffon photograph collage
Description: This silk chiffon photo collage of the Illinois Vietnam Memorial in downtown Chicago came together on a rainy November day as I attended a Veteran’s memorial service at Chicago’s riverfront Vietnam Veteran’s Memorial. The memorial is formal, yet the fountains of water that spring from the front of wall of names speaks to a freedom that these men and women fought for. The vines in the photograph represent the jungle through which both sides had to fight. My father was KIA in Vietnam in 1967, and while at the memorial service I met a nurse who may very well have cared for him in the Pleiku field hospital.
